Volunteer duties include assisting a library staff member to facilitate a reading group for up to 5 to 6 people with dementia.
Reading groups for dementia sufferers are planned for the City Library, Mosgiel Library, and Waikouaiti library (and potentially other libraries in the Dunedin Public Libraries system). The one-hour long meeting will take place during a week day (yet to be decided), between the hours of 10am and 3pm.
You will help set up morning or afternoon tea (depending on Covid-19 settings), communicate with group attendees and their caregivers, assist people with reading, and be willing to read aloud and take part in discussions sparked by stories in the texts. You will gain confidence and experience working with vulnerable and mostly older people.
